How it works

Connect Slack and MongoDB Atlas in five steps.

No code, no glue, no half-day setup. Each step is one click.

  1. 1
    Connect
    Authorize Slack and MongoDB Atlas

    Open Tiny Command, authorize Slack and MongoDB Atlas once each. Both connections are available to every workflow on your account.

  2. 2
    Trigger
    Pick a Slack trigger

    Drop the Slack → App Home Opened trigger onto the canvas. Tiny Command auto-registers the webhook.

    POST /v1/webhooks/slack.trigger-app-home-opened
  3. 3
    Transform
    Add a filter or AI step

    Optionally add a Filter node ("subject contains URGENT") or an AI step ("classify intent") between trigger and action.

  4. 4
    Action
    Add the MongoDB Atlas action

    Drop the MongoDB Atlas → Find MongoDB Documents action below it. Map fields from the Slack payload into the MongoDB Atlas inputs.

    mongodb-atlas.find
  5. 5
    Publish
    Publish and forget

    Hit Publish. Tiny Command runs it in production from second one. Watch the run-log fill up.
